Abstract :
The paper discusses a parallel, multiprocessor implementation of methods based on partial differential equations (PDE). It focuses on the implementation requirements of segmentation by active contours. Here, the key task is the accurate computation of an implicit description of the contours, i.e. the distance map. This paper demonstrates the use of the proposed architecture by giving a hardware implementation of the distance transform based on the parallel Massive Marching algorithm. The extension of the non-linear filtering implementation is also proposed.
